On Monday, my lower eyelids begain to itch. My eyes themselves felt fine - only the lids itched. By the next day, my lower lids were a little red and a bit swollen. Itchy feeling was still there and more prominent about 1/4 inch BELOW the eyes. My top lids look pretty normal and the whites of my eyes are still white - no yellowing and no redness at all.



Tuesday night I used an allergy eye drop and took benedryl before bed. This morning both lids look and feel worse and STILL itch. Wednesday (yesterday), I used a couple drops of colloidal silver in each eye in the afternoon and again before bed (to kill the apparent infection) as well as cold compresses to keep swelling down.  my eye lids STILL itched during the night and this morning the swelling is now on my top eyelids and the swelling of the lower lids has spread slightly visibly to my cheekbones - looks a bit puffy - My eyes are NOT swollen shut, nor are they weepy or crusty. I can also feel the swelling down toward my lips a bit - though it is not visibly noticeable.



The only think I can think of is maybe an allergic reaction to detergent or fabric softner on the washclothes I used to wash my face while visiting out of town last weekend (itchiness first appeared on Monday). But it doesn't make sense to me that this could be continuing/getting worse now that I've been away from the source since Sunday. Any ideas of WHAT else could be causing this?

You're right, its most likely an allergic response.  It is most likely NOT an infection of any kind.



Taking benadryl is a great idea, as are cold compresses.  Try very hard NOT to rub or scratch your eyes or face at all.  Use a prescribed topical anti-inflammatory eyedrop, not visine or "ocular decongestants" that contain naphazoline or phenylephrine, etc.



If it gets bad enough you might need an exam and prescribed ocular steroids.
